NOV is actively recruiting a Quality Control Inspector for our Cedar Park, TX facility. The successful candidate will perform a wide variety of inspection and quality control operations of a visual, dimensional, and functional nature, making necessary critical observations, tests, or competing appropriate documentation as required. In addition, perform a mechanical inspection on precision machined parts, and create non-conformance reports for all parts that do not meet specifications. As well as support engineers, machinists, and all NOV employees to ensure products are made to print. This is a non-exempt onsite position for day shift work and is eligible for overtime pay when pre-approved by Management.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ES: • Perform inspections on components. • Perform source inspections at facilities. • Prepare inspection reports and maintain files of inspection documents. • Review inspection records received for compliance. • Maintain inspection and measuring equipment. • Prepare and coordinate Non-Conformance Reports (NCR’s) for nonconforming parts. • Perform other work-related tasks as assigned. • Comply with all NOV Company and HSE policies and procedures. FACILITY
RESPONSIBILITIES: • Perform In the process, final, and receiving inspection, and work with inspectors and manufacturing employees in other inspection areas. Inspections are made against drawings, specifications, and/or instructions. Accountable for product/process incoming and/or final inspection activities required for purchased and manufactured parts, respectively, and processes. • Responsible for the proper care of all company tools and measuring equipment before, during, and after use • Ensure that all gages are in calibration, clean, and free of rust, as well as in good working conditions at all times before use and traceable to/from their assigned storage location. • Ensure that all records are kept accurately updated according to established procedures • Identify discrepancies and prepare non-conformity reports. • Observe safety regulations, wear all required safety equipment, encourage safe working practices, correct obvious hazards immediately, or reports them to supervisors.
